triage-sweep
FeaturedBackfill labels across oh-my-hermes issues and pull requests. Run manually to sweep everything currently unlabeled, or pass a number to triage one item. Use when issues and PRs have accumulated without labels, after adding a new label to .github/labels.yml, or before a release when the backlog needs to be readable by area.
